A view of Kingston harbour, Kingston town and the Blue Mountains taken on board the refrigerated fruit carrier Jamaica Planter (1959) The photographer is standing on the port side of the ship looking north west towards the Blue mountains. A number of cars and trucks are parked on the quayside in the foreground. Beyond the parked cars is the town of Kingston. The Blue Mountains are in the background. This is Slide 15 of Captain Henry P. Bird's lecture titled "Caribbean Cargoes", about his service as Second Officer on board Jamaica Planter (1959) and Port Officer for Jamaica Banana Producers Steam Ship Company based at Kingston, Jamaica from 6 January 1971 to 26 April 1971. The lecture consists of 45 slides.
